Why Freezer Organization Matters for Nutrition and Waste

The freezer is meant to be a pause button for food, but disorganization turns that pause into permanent storage. When items are stacked without labels or logic, older packages sink to the bottom or get buried behind newer purchases. Months later, they resurface unrecognizable, freezer-burned, or simply forgotten, and the natural response is to throw them out.

That pattern matters for more than convenience. Every discarded item represents nutrients and money that never made it to a meal. A bag of vegetables frozen at peak ripeness carries real nutritional value, but only if it is eaten before quality declines. Proper organization reduces the likelihood of forgotten, wasted food by keeping stock visible and accessible, which means the vitamins and minerals locked into that food actually get consumed rather than binned.

There is also a psychological angle worth considering. A cluttered, disorganized freezer discourages cooking from scratch, because finding ingredients feels like a chore. People default to convenience foods or takeout instead, which can shift a household away from the whole, natural ingredients they intended to rely on. An organized freezer, by contrast, makes it easier to see exactly what is on hand, which supports more intentional, nutrient-conscious meal planning rather than last-minute substitutions.

The Science of Freezing: What Happens to Nutrients

Freezing works by halting the biological activity that causes food to spoil. Bacteria and mold need moisture and warmth to multiply, and once temperatures drop low enough, that growth stops almost entirely. This is different from refrigeration, which only slows microbial activity without stopping it, meaning refrigerated food continues to degrade, just more slowly than food left at room temperature.

Enzymes present naturally in fruits and vegetables also play a role in nutrient loss. These enzymes keep working even after harvest, gradually breaking down cell structures and, with them, certain vitamins. Freezing slows this enzymatic activity considerably, which is one reason frozen produce is generally thought to hold onto more of its original nutrient content than produce that spends extended time in refrigerated storage. Vitamin C, in particular, is sensitive to time, light, and oxygen exposure, and it tends to be more stable under frozen conditions than under ordinary refrigeration.

This does not mean freezing preserves every nutrient perfectly or indefinitely. Some vitamins are more heat- and processing-sensitive than others, and quality still declines gradually during long-term frozen storage due to slow oxidation and moisture loss, often visible as freezer burn. The broader point is one of comparison rather than perfection: freezing can slow nutrient degradation compared to prolonged refrigeration, which makes it a useful strategy for anyone trying to stretch the shelf life of fresh produce, meats, or home-cooked meals without sacrificing much nutritional value.

Smart Storage Habits That Preserve Freshness

Good freezer habits are less about equipment and more about a handful of consistent routines. The first is labeling, ideally including both the contents and the date it was frozen. Without a date, even a well-organized freezer becomes a guessing game, and guessing usually ends with food being either thrown out too early or kept too long.

Closely related is the “first in, first out” principle borrowed from commercial kitchens. New items get placed behind or below older ones, so the oldest stock is always the first one grabbed. This single habit prevents the common scenario where a fresh bag of bread sits on top while an older, better-suited-for-immediate-use loaf freezer-burns underneath, unused and eventually wasted.

Portioning food before freezing is another habit with real nutritional payoff. A large block of soup or a whole tray of casserole, frozen as one unit, forces a choice: thaw the entire thing or none of it. Repeated thawing and refreezing, even partial, accelerates texture breakdown and nutrient loss, since each freeze-thaw cycle ruptures more cell walls and exposes more of the food to oxygen. Freezing in individual or meal-sized portions avoids that cycle entirely, since only what is needed gets thawed at a time. A simple way to visualize these habits together:

  • Label every item with contents and freeze date before it goes in.
  • Place new purchases behind existing stock rather than in front.
  • Freeze in portions sized for a single meal rather than one large block.

None of these habits require special tools, only a bit of consistency, but together they meaningfully reduce both spoilage and the nutrient loss that comes from repeated temperature changes.

How Kitchen Design Supports Better Food Habits

Habits are easier to maintain when the environment makes them convenient, and freezer design plays a bigger role in this than many people expect. A built-in freezer where every item is stacked in an opaque bin, three layers deep, actively works against labeling and rotation habits, because seeing what is inside requires digging. Drawers with transparent fronts solve this at a structural level: contents are visible at a glance, so older packages are not accidentally buried and forgotten behind newer ones.

This kind of visibility directly supports the FIFO habit already discussed. Clear visibility of stored items helps people use food before it spoils, simply because the reminder is passive rather than something that has to be actively recalled. Instead of trying to remember what is at the back of a drawer, a quick glance shows exactly what needs to be used soon. For households trying to eat more intentionally and waste less, this small design difference can outweigh a much more disciplined labeling system in a poorly designed unit.

Smooth-running telescopic rails contribute a similar benefit from a different angle. When a drawer glides open fully and easily under load, reorganizing it takes seconds rather than becoming a wrestling match with stuck trays or items falling out of reach. That ease makes it far more likely that a person will actually do a quick freshness check every so often, rather than avoiding the drawer because it is difficult to pull open or awkward to search through. Small frictions like a jammed rail or a bin that has to be lifted out to see the bottom are often enough to make someone skip a check they would otherwise do, so removing that friction has a real, if understated, effect on how consistently good habits actually get followed.

Simple Steps to a Healthier Freezer Routine

Turning these ideas into practice does not require an overhaul, just a repeatable weekly rhythm. Setting aside a few minutes once a week to scan freezer contents, check dates, and move older items forward keeps the FIFO system functioning instead of quietly breaking down over time. This short routine catches problems while they are still small, before a forgotten package becomes an inevitable discard.

Grouping food by type and date also simplifies meal planning considerably. Keeping proteins in one section, vegetables in another, and ready-made meals in a third means a weekly menu can be built around what is already on hand rather than defaulting to a fresh grocery run every time. This approach naturally prioritizes older stock, since it becomes visible and top-of-mind during planning rather than an afterthought.

Over weeks and months, these small habits compound. A household that checks its freezer weekly, labels consistently, and portions food thoughtfully will waste noticeably less than one relying on memory alone, and the food it does eat will tend to reflect the nutrient value it had going into the freezer, not a diminished version of it. None of this depends on any single product or gadget; it depends on a routine that fits into how a kitchen is actually used, week after week, without becoming another chore to avoid.
